Beating the Bounds
As part of the Centenary Scouting year the whole of Avon Scout boundaries were walked on one day. We did our part with a slightly windswpet walk from Portishead Open Air Pool (which was strangely closed...) to Clevedon's Ladye Bay. 13 Scouts plus the usual splattering of adults joined together for what turned out to be a pleasant morning. (If not a little rushed at the end)...
